Etymology[edit]
Anglicized form of Welsh ap Einion (“son of Einion”), a Welsh personal name.
Proper noun[edit]
Bennion (plural Bennions)
- A surname from Welsh.
Statistics[edit]
- According to the 2010 United States Census, Bennion is the 16679th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 1717 individuals. Bennion is most common among White (95.34%) individuals.
